I submit defeat. I have been trying to configure my remote Linux box to have two dummy monitors so that I can use multiple local monitors to VNC into it. I'm surprised that no one else has needed help with this to find something on the web.
I've also tried creating a monitor on the Linux box that is double wide. Then use x11vnc to -clip an area for each display. But I'm having issues creating a monitor that large with the dummy driver.
I do have a graphics adapter installed that has two DisplayPorts but am not planning to use it. When I was using the real adapter, I was getting sluggish behavior. When I tried the dummy, it was very responsive. So I'm hoping to just create another dummy.
I'm using KDE DM.
I have seen many examples of using VIRTUAL1 but I can't get that working with the dummy driver. I tried adding Option "VirtualHeads" "2" into the config but the dummy driver doesn't recognize it.
I’ve seen suggestions of using Xvfb but it has been deprecated by the dummy driver since 2016.

**Edit 2021-05-27:**
More lurking and I found some options. I was able to get a double wide screen and then create two x11vnc instances. But this isn't optimal. The Linux box still sees this as a single screen. Now is there a way to take that screen and tell the Linux box to split it? For example, if I maximize a window in KDE it will not span both local screens?
Xorg conf file:
Section "Monitor"
Identifier "Monitor0"
EndSection
Section "Device"
Identifier "Card0"
Driver "dummy"
VideoRam 512000
EndSection
Section "Screen"
Identifier "Screen0"
Device "Card0"
Monitor "Monitor0"
DefaultDepth 24
SubSection "Display"
Depth 24
Virtual 3840 1080
EndSubSection
EndSection
x11vnc -loop -forever -shared -repeat -noxdamage -xrandr -display :0 -rfbport 5900 -clip 1920x1080+0+0
x11vnc -loop -forever -shared -repeat -noxdamage -xrandr -display :0 -rfbport 5901 -clip 1920x1080+1920+0
I can then connect to VNC displays :0 and :1 and arrange them on local monitors and resize the windows to fit those monitors.
When a dialog window appears, many times it's in the middle of the Linux "big screen" which for me spans both monitors...
